/** * @typedef {import('./cart').CartData} CartData * @typedef {import('./cart').CartShippingAddress} CartShippingAddress */ /** * @typedef {Object} StoreCart * * @property {Array} cartCoupons An array of coupons applied * to the cart. * @property {Array} cartItems An array of items in the * cart. * @property {number} cartItemsCount The number of items in the * cart. * @property {number} cartItemsWeight The weight of all items in * the cart. * @property {boolean} cartNeedsPayment True when the cart will * require payment. * @property {boolean} cartNeedsShipping True when the cart will * require shipping. * @property {Array} cartItemErrors Item validation errors. * @property {Object} cartTotals Cart and line total * amounts. * @property {boolean} cartIsLoading True when cart data is * being loaded. * @property {Array} cartErrors An array of errors thrown * by the cart. * @property {CartShippingAddress} shippingAddress Shipping address for the * cart. * @property {Array} shippingRates array of selected shipping * rates. * @property {boolean} shippingRatesLoading Whether or not the * shipping rates are * being loaded. * @property {boolean} hasShippingAddress Whether or not the cart * has a shipping address yet. * @property {function(Object):any} receiveCart Dispatcher to receive * updated cart. */ /** * @typedef {Object} StoreCartCoupon * * @property {Array} appliedCoupons Collection of applied coupons from the * API. * @property {boolean} isLoading True when coupon data is being loaded. * @property {Function} applyCoupon Callback for applying a coupon by code. * @property {Function} removeCoupon Callback for removing a coupon by code. * @property {boolean} isApplyingCoupon True when a coupon is being applied. * @property {boolean} isRemovingCoupon True when a coupon is being removed. */ /** * @typedef {Object} StoreCartItemAddToCart * * @property {number} cartQuantity The quantity of the item in the * cart. * @property {boolean} addingToCart Whether the cart item is still * being added or not. * @property {boolean} cartIsLoading Whether the cart is being loaded. * @property {Function} addToCart Callback for adding a cart item. */ /** * @typedef {Object} StoreCartItemQuantity * * @property {number} quantity The quantity of the item in the * cart. * @property {boolean} isPendingDelete Whether the cart item is being * deleted or not. * @property {Function} changeQuantity Callback for changing quantity * of item in cart. * @property {Function} removeItem Callback for removing a cart item. * @property {Object} cartItemQuantityErrors An array of errors thrown by * the cart. */ /** * @typedef {Object} EmitResponseTypes * * @property {string} SUCCESS To indicate a success response. * @property {string} FAIL To indicate a failed response. * @property {string} ERROR To indicate an error response. */ /** * @typedef {Object} NoticeContexts * * @property {string} PAYMENTS Notices for the payments step. * @property {string} EXPRESS_PAYMENTS Notices for the express payments step. */ /* eslint-disable jsdoc/valid-types */ // Enum format below triggers the above rule even though VSCode interprets it fine. /** * @typedef {NoticeContexts['PAYMENTS']|NoticeContexts['EXPRESS_PAYMENTS']} NoticeContextsEnum */ /** * @typedef {Object} EmitSuccessResponse * * @property {EmitResponseTypes['SUCCESS']} type Should have the value of * EmitResponseTypes.SUCCESS. * @property {string} [redirectUrl] If the redirect url should be changed set * this. Note, this is ignored for some * emitters. * @property {Object} [meta] Additional data returned for the success * response. This varies between context * emitters. */ /** * @typedef {Object} EmitFailResponse * * @property {EmitResponseTypes['FAIL']} type Should have the value of * EmitResponseTypes.FAIL * @property {string} message A message to trigger a notice for. * @property {NoticeContextsEnum} [messageContext] What context to display any message in. * @property {Object} [meta] Additional data returned for the fail * response. This varies between context * emitters. */ /** * @typedef {Object} EmitErrorResponse * * @property {EmitResponseTypes['ERROR']} type Should have the value of * EmitResponseTypes.ERROR * @property {string} message A message to trigger a notice for. * @property {boolean} retry If false, then it means an * irrecoverable error so don't allow for * shopper to retry checkout (which may * mean either a different payment or * fixing validation errors). * @property {Object} [validationErrors] If provided, will be set as validation * errors in the validation context. * @property {NoticeContextsEnum} [messageContext] What context to display any message in. * @property {Object} [meta] Additional data returned for the fail * response. This varies between context * emitters. */ /* eslint-enable jsdoc/valid-types */ /** * @typedef {Object} EmitResponseApi * * @property {EmitResponseTypes} responseTypes An object of various response types that can * be used in returned response objects. * @property {NoticeContexts} noticeContexts An object of various notice contexts that can * be used for targeting where a notice appears. * @property {function(Object):boolean} shouldRetry Returns whether the user is allowed to retry * the payment after a failed one. * @property {function(Object):boolean} isSuccessResponse Returns whether the given response is of a * success response type. * @property {function(Object):boolean} isErrorResponse Returns whether the given response is of an * error response type. * @property {function(Object):boolean} isFailResponse Returns whether the given response is of a * fail response type. */ export {}; /** * Internal dependencies */ import { ACTION_TYPES as types } from './action-types'; /** * Action creator for setting a single query-state value for a given context. * * @param {string} context Context for query state being stored. * @param {string} queryKey Key for query item. * @param {*} value The value for the query item. * * @return {Object} The action object. */ export const setQueryValue = ( context, queryKey, value ) => { return { type: types.SET_QUERY_KEY_VALUE, context, queryKey, value, }; }; /** * Action creator for setting query-state for a given context. * * @param {string} context Context for query state being stored. * @param {*} value Query state being stored for the given context. * * @return {Object} The action object. */ export const setValueForQueryContext = ( context, value ) => { return { type: types.SET_QUERY_CONTEXT_VALUE, context, value, }; };

Cửa Hàng Phụ Kiện Camera

Phụ kiện camera đa dạng, chính hãng, giá tốt

Hoş Geldin Bonusu ile casinomaxi twitter Çevrimiçi Kumarhane - Cửa Hàng Phụ Kiện Camera

Hoş Geldin Bonusu ile casinomaxi twitter Çevrimiçi Kumarhane

Hoş geldin bonusu teklifi olan çevrimiçi kumarhane, yeni katılımcıları almak için casinomaxi twitter oluşturulmuştur. Bu makalede, kayıt bonusları, katkıda bulunanların biçimlerine uyum sağlamak için çeşitli biçimlerde gelir. Bununla birlikte, bir ek ifade ettiğinizde, ifadeleri tamamen okuduğunuzdan emin olun.

Bir kumarhane bonusunun boyutları ve kumar oynamaya başlama kuralları beklenen endişelerdir. Ayrıca, her avantaj için desteklenen herhangi bir oyun başlığının farkında olacaksınız.

Bonuslar

Bir çevrimiçi kumarhane hoş geldin bonusu, herhangi bir çevrimiçi bahis hissini gerçekten başlatmak için mükemmel bir yöntemdir. Bu, gerçekten depozitonun bir alanıdır veya belki de orijinal depozitonun tüm süresini ele alabilir. Bununla birlikte, aşağıdaki bonuslar bilmeniz gereken bir dizi koşulla birlikte gelmeye devam ediyor. Bunlar, yeni bir kazancı ortadan kaldırmak istiyorsanız eşleştirmeniz gereken zaman ve bonusu kullanmaya başlama ve bahis benzersiz kodlarının miktarıdır.

Yeni bir çevrimiçi kumarhanenin hoş geldin ödülü ne kadar önemli veya küçük olursa olsun, ihtiyaçlarınıza uygun olanı bulmanız gerekir. Dahil olmak üzere, en sık katıldığınız oyunların belirli bir ödülünü seçin ve başlatın. En büyük talep sürecinde gerçek eşarplar için ek bir bonus seçmek açıkça iyi bir fikirdir. Bu, bir çevrimiçi kumarhane ödül fonunun kaybolma şansını durdurmaya yardımcı olacaktır.

Missouri’deki gerçek paralı çevrimiçi kumarhanelerin çoğu, yeni katılımcıların ilk saatlik yatırım yapmalarını ve sitedeki şanslarını denemelerini teşvik etmek için kumarhane peşinat bonusları koyar. Burada internet kumarhanesi bonusları genellikle gerçek peşinat bonus kredileriyle belirli bir sınıra kadar bir paya sahiptir. En fazla kumarhane peşinat ödülü, yere bağlı olarak genellikle en az 1.000 dolardır. Yeni bir çevrimiçi kumarhane tarafından sağlanan diğer bazı bonus anlaşmaları, ücretsiz dönüşler ve anında jetonlar başlatır. Bunlar, yalnızca belirli video poker makineleri veya belki de megaway çevrimiçi oyunları için devam etmesini sağlayan daha büyük bir hoş geldin paketinin veya yeniden doldurma avantajının ayrılmaz bir parçasıdır.

Mevcut oyunlar

İnternet kumarhane şirketleri açıkça agresiftir ve çevrimiçi kumarhaneler katılımcıları birbirine bağlamak için bir dizi numara alır. Özellikle modern bir teknik, yeni kişilere oyunları denemek için fayda parası sağlayan teşvik edilen bir ekstradır. Aşağıdaki açılış özellikleri, genel kumar hissini büyük ölçüde artırabilir ve kişilerin geri dönmesini önerebilir. Ancak keyfini sürmeye başlamadan önce, o reklamların şartlarını görmeye başlamanız gerekiyor.

Hoş bonuslar genellikle tamamen ücretsiz dönüşler, peşinat karşılıkları veya hatta bazen şeklinde gelir. İnternet kumarhanesine göre, çok farklı toplam aralıklar ve koşul türleridir. Ayrıca, daha düşük tam aralıklar ve başlangıç ​​kısıtlamaları olsa da hoş bonuslar gibi olan ek bonuslar veya haftada bir kez fırsatlar da sağlar. Bu iki bonus, paranızı çok fazla zaman riske atmadan çevrimiçi kumarhane duygusundan en iyi şekilde yararlanmanıza yardımcı olabilir.

Teşvik edilen avantajı seçerken, bahis gereksinimleri olduğu ve dairesel bilgi hizmeti ücretlerini başlattığı için yeni bir pazarlamanın boyutunu bulmak da gereklidir. Bu 4 unsur muhtemelen kazancınızı ne kadar harcayabileceğinizi ve herkesin avantajı ne kadar hızlı temizlemek isteyeceğini öğrenir. Bu 4 unsurun dikkate alınması, belirli bir şekilde avantajınızdan en yüksek kaliteyi elde ettiğinizden ve çevrimiçi bahis oynamanın tüm yardımının tadını çıkarabileceğinizden emin olmanızı sağlayacaktır.

Şarj olanakları

Çevrimiçi kumarhaneler size güvenli bir depozito seviyesi sunar ve seçenekler almaya başlar. Bunlar bir kredi kartı, banka kartı, internet bankası, PayPal, Venmo ve bu kartları başlatır. Bu tür olasılıklar, para hareketlerinizin güvenli hissetmesini ve ticari işlemleri başlatmasını sağlamak için 132 Bit üçlü manto SSL güvenliğini kullanır. Ancak, bazı erken ilkbahar yolları diğerlerinden daha fazla bahis içerir. Dahil olmak üzere, kredi kartı ekstreleri konum hırsızlığına karşı savunmasız olabilir.

Çevrimiçi kumarhane hoş bonus anlaşmaları, yeni katılımcıları gerçek parayla oynamaya başlamak için kız depozitosundan belirli bir sınıra kadar fayda kesintileri için koyar. Bir hisse uzmanı türüne yenik düşerler, örneğin, çevrimiçi kumarhane size kredilerde 200 $ daha değerleme verir. Aşağıdaki kayıt bonuslarının boyutu bir kişiden diğerine değişir, ancak çoğu kesinlikle beklemenizi önermek için oluşturulmuştur.

Yatırma oranları gibi yeni bir peşinat olasılığı, internet kumarhanesinde yeni bir banka belgesi paylaşmanızı gerektirir, bu nedenle bir yatırma yöntemi almadan önce hüküm ve koşulları dikkatlice okuduğunuzdan emin olun. Herhangi bir harcama ve başlangıç ​​dezavantajı kısıtlaması vardır. Ek olarak, çok sayıda çevrimiçi kumarhane, reklamları çekmek için benzersiz kodlara layıktır. Birçok kişi, bir kumarhane ekranı için yararlıdır – tamamen fayda veya yeniden doldurma bonusları ve bir özveri tasarımı yoluyla kazanılan ödülleri başlatma gibi ömür boyu teklifler talep etmek için.

Dağıtımlardaki sınırlamalar

En iyi çevrimiçi kumarhaneler size bir dizi hoş bonus verme eğilimindedir. Burada ücretsiz fonlar, ekstra dönüşler ve bir peşinat yüzdesi olabilir. Aşağıdaki bonuslar, sizin için ne zaman uygun olduğunu görmek için web sitesiyle başsağlığınızı satın almanıza yardımcı olabilir.Genellikle, aşağıdaki kayıt bonusları yalnızca 30 saniyeniz için kullanılabilir. Gerçekten kaçırmamak için, her çevrimiçi kumarhanenin terminolojisini kontrol etmeye çalışın ve ne kadar uzun ve başlangıç ​​ifadeleri olduğunu keşfedin.

Çoğu çevrimiçi kumarhane, yeni bir oyuncunun hesaplarını kullanarak ne kadar çekebileceği konusunda sınırlamalar kullanır. Bu makalede, sınırlar bir çevrimiçi kumarhaneden diğerine değişir, ancak bir kişinin kararlılığına ve çevrimiçi kumarhanede Özel oda onayına bağlı olma eğilimindedirler.Sınırlamalar ayrıca yeni bir profesyonelin tedarik edilen bir çağdan gelen geri dönüşler yaptığı zaman sayısına da bağlı olabilir. Yeni bir kumarhane, çok fazla para kaybını önlemek için bireyler için en az çekilme miktarına sahiptir.

İnternetteki yeni bir kumarhane hoş bonus fırsatları, belirli bir slot turundan sonra gerçekten bonus dönüşleri olabilir. Bu, paranızı riske atmadan turu bulmanın harika bir yolu olabilir. Yine de, ve başlatma, tüm bu dönüşlerden ödeme yapmaz, bunlar alınmadan önce kumar kodlarına tabi olma eğilimindedir. Ek olarak, blackjack ve başlangıç ​​​​filmi oynama gibi seçili video oyunları, hepsinden gelen yeni bir bahis ön koşuluna bağlı değildir.

Main Menu